E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ures the intensity and chaos of the Battle of Solferino, a pivotal moment in Italian history. Taking place on 24 June 1859 during the Second Italian War of Independence, this battle marked a significant step towards Italy's unification. The image showcases a vivid color lithograph by Joseph Charles Beuzon, depicting the fierce clash between Austrian and French forces on the battlefield. The scene is filled with cavalry charges, infantry formations, and artillery fire as both sides fight for control. The composition beautifully portrays the desperation and determination of soldiers engaged in combat. The smoke-filled air adds to the sense of chaos while emphasizing the brutality of war. Each soldier's face reveals their individual struggle amidst this larger conflict. The Battle of Solferino was not just a military confrontation; it represented an ideological clash between those fighting for independence and those seeking to maintain dominance over Italy. This historic event played a crucial role in shaping Italy's future as it fought for its identity and unity.
